BAKU, Azerbaijan, January 14. The value of ICT services provided in Uzbekistan from January through November 2022 worth 13.1 billion soums ($1.1 million), Trend reports via Uzbek State Statistics Committee.
According to statistics, this figure increased by 21.9 percent compared to the January through November 2021 figure (10.8 billion soums or $953,649).
Furthermore, during the reporting period, the value of transport services amounted to 73.3 trillion soums ($6.5 billion), trade services – 80.3 trillion soums ($7.1 billion), and financial services – 72.7 trillion soums ($6.4 billion).
The growth rate of ICT services, by region:
Andijan - 29.3 percent
Surkhandarya – 28.6 percent
Tashkent - 28.6 percent
Jizzak – 27 percent
Namangan - 26.9 percent
Ferghana - 26.5 percent
Kashkadarya - 25.6 percent
Samarkand – 25.4 percent
Sirdorya – 24.7 percent
Khorezm - 24.4 percent
Bukhara - 23.0 percent
Karakalpakstan - 20.5 percent
Navoi region - 21.5 percent
Tashkent - 17.1 percent.
